Output 668359c5632df264d1276fa0472196d077149ecae721562eafa539ba68f4642c:0

value
1578659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caa9acfe138f7c03adc6591c7159783f2d709bd2 OP_EQUALVERIFY OP_CHECKSIG
address
1KUam2c55pce3n21CcEXajZy9Ex1BGmuRM
transaction
668359c5632df264d1276fa0472196d077149ecae721562eafa539ba68f4642c
spent
true